A 10g wine stabiliser used with sulphite after fermentation to help prevent renewed yeast activity before sweetening or bottling.
How to use
Ensure fermentation has finished and the wine is clear and stable. After treating with the appropriate Campden or sulphite addition, use ½ teaspoon per 5L as directed.
Helpful information
Potassium sorbate does not stop an active fermentation and does not replace sulphite or sanitation. Follow a proven stabilising and backsweetening method.
